Cultural Attractions

While in Bentonville, discover the city's rich cultural offerings. Crystal Bridges Museum of American Art, with its stunning architecture and impressive collection, is free to visit and a must-see attraction. Explore the Momentary, a cutting-edge contemporary art space housed in a decommissioned cheese factory. Don't miss the Museum of Native American History, which provides a fascinating glimpse into the region's indigenous heritage.

Outdoor Adventures

Bentonville's natural beauty and extensive trail systems make it a haven for outdoor enthusiasts. Rent a bike and explore the city's comprehensive network of paved and mountain biking trails, winding through lush forests, next to spring-fed creeks, and up and down the hills and hollers of the Ozark mountains. For a more leisurely experience, stroll through the Bentonville Square, a charming downtown area lined with local boutiques, restaurants, and art galleries.
